The book of Judges reveals how Israel's tribes gradually compromised God's commands after Joshua's death. Starting with Benjamin's failure to drive out the Jebusites from Jerusalem, each tribe became progressively less obedient, choosing seemingly practical compromises over complete surrender. From Manasseh's forced labor system to Dan's complete territorial failure, we see how partial obedience leads to spiritual decline. This ancient pattern mirrors our modern struggles with compromise in areas like finances, relationships, and witness. God doesn't demand perfection, but He does require obedience and complete surrender rather than comfortable compromise.

The tribe of Judah experienced remarkable victories in conquering the Promised Land, defeating giants and capturing fortified cities through God's power. However, their campaign reveals how small compromises can lead to significant consequences. When faced with iron chariots in the coastal plains, Judah chose to avoid the challenge rather than trust God's ability to overcome superior technology. This seemingly minor decision to leave one area unconquered has had lasting implications for thousands of years. The story demonstrates that while God blesses imperfect obedience, our small compromises can create long-term difficulties and missed opportunities for experiencing His full power.

Key TakeawaysCoaching ≠ outperforming. Performance expertise and coaching expertise are different muscles.Discomfort is data. If growth feels easy, you're probably not growing.Trust follows vulnerability. Coaching conversations require safety, time, and honesty.Aim feedback at the work. Focus on the task/approach, not the person.Decide your mode. Coach, teach, or direct based on the question, urgency, and learning goal.Beat imposter syndrome with action. If the finish line is fuzzy, take the next step and practice.
